What to check before for buildings highly rated for trash management near the M103 bus in Lower East Side

  • Use best-trash-management as your starting point, then confirm the trash setup that matters to you (collection times, chute vs. room, and how residents handle bulky items).
  • Treat M103 as a routing convenience: verify walking time from the building entrance to the nearest stop and check for alternate bus patterns during hours you’d commute.
  • Check any rules that affect moving days and bulk pickup, since trash-management performance can depend on consistent resident behavior.
  • Compare the full building picture in the same workflow: rated buildings scores plus practical notes in reviews and tenant Q&A.
  • If you’re sensitive to odors or pests, don’t stop at a filter score—message the building for current practices and seasonal issues.
